20 июня, 2023
Градация специалистов Junior, Middle и Senior: значение и необходимость классификации уровней
Исследуйте градацию уровней: senior, junior, middle. Отличия, позиции, навыки, зарплаты. Уровни программирования и дизайна. Различия между junior и middle. Уровни: junior, middle, senior. Разница в навыках. Отличие мидла от сеньора. Junior, middle, senior в программировании и дизайне.
Навигация по странице
HR-менеджеры обычно подразделяют специалистов на различные уровни: Junior, Middle и Senior. Классифицируют их на основе опыта работы, навыков и степени ответственности.
Кто такой Junior:
- Студент последних курсов или выпускник без опыта работы в данной сфере.
- Нуждается в постоянном обучении и руководстве.
- Способен выполнять простые и некритические задачи.
- Ожидается, что сможет реализовывать около 80% задач с хорошим качеством.
- Обычно задерживается на позиции около 1-1,5 лет.
Кто такой Middle:
- Самостоятелен и может выполнять ответственную работу.
- Обладает опытом работы в своей сфере и может помогать Junior-специалистам.
- Способен выполнять все свои задачи качественно.
- Вовлечен в общие вопросы и обсуждения с командой.
- Может находиться на этой позиции в течение длительного времени, если не стремится к росту.
Кто такой Senior:
- Опытный и высококвалифицированный специалист.
- Один из лучших сотрудников в компании.
- Обычно выполняет работу на высоком уровне, даже превышая ожидания.
- Может занимать руководящие позиции и иметь опционы в компании.
- Для достижения этой позиции требуется значительный опыт работы (обычно 5-7 лет).
В разных сферах могут быть некоторые отличия в том, как быстро специалисты растут и достигают новых уровней. Например, веб-разработчики могут расти быстрее, так как этот сегмент эффективно развивается, в то время как разработчикам игр требуется больше времени для набора опыта, так как это специфическая область.
Джун — первый шаг в профессиональной карьере
Джун, или Junior — это молодой специалист без значительного опыта работы в соответствующей области. Чаще всего это студенты старших курсов, выпускники или стажеры с базовыми знаниями в IT-сфере. Джуниоры начинают свой путь с выполнения несложных задач в малых проектах, которые требуют постоянного ревью и руководства. Они активно учатся, задают много вопросов и совершенствуют свои навыки.
Что должно быть в портфолио джуниора
Для джуниор-разработчика важно иметь ппортфолио, в котором будут указаны навыки и проекты, выполненные в процессе обучения или стажировки. В портфолио должны быть примеры базового программного кода, небольшие проекты или задачи, над которыми работал джун. Это позволяет потенциальным работодателям оценить его потенциал и готовность к выполнению задач в профессиональной среде.
Soft Skills для Junior-разработчика: развитие важных навыков
Помимо технических навыков, джун должен обладать определенными софтскилами. Важно уметь задавать вопросы, активно слушать и принимать критику, а также быть готовым к постоянному обучению и развитию. В приоритете коммуникационные навыки, способность работать в команде и ответственность за свою часть работы в проектной группе.
Зарплата Junior-разработчика: рыночные стандарты и ожидания
Зарплата разработчика уровня Junior зависит от местоположения, размера компании, специализации и уровня конкуренции на рынке труда. Обычно джун получает начальный уровень заработной платы, который ниже, чем у более опытных коллег, но все же обеспечивает приличный уровень жизни.
Совет эксперта: как джуну перейти на следующий уровень
- Активно развивайтесь и стремитесь к совершенствованию.
- Обратите внимание на углубление в технические знания, изучайте больше материалов по своей сфере деятельности, прокачивайте скиллы.
- Участвуйте в сложных проектах и работайте с более опытными коллегами.
- Посещайте профессиональные мероприятия, обучающие курсы и принимать участие в open-source проектах для расширения своей сети контактов и приобретения новых навыков.
Следуя этим советам джун быстрее прокачает свои скиллы, чтобы перейти на новый уровень в профессиональной карьере и стать middle.
Junior, Middle и Senior — это лишь ступени на пути к совершенству программиста. Не бойтесь подниматься выше, стремиться к новым вершинам и превосходить самого себя, ведь именно так мы растем и развиваемся в мире технологий.
Middle-developer: определение и требуемые навыки
Middle-разработчик, или мидл — это специалист, который находится между уровнями Junior и Senior. У него есть уже опыт работы и знания, чтобы решать более сложные задачи и принимать активное участие в работе команды. Мидл-программист обычно командный игрок, который может предлагать идеи по архитектуре и стратегиям, а также работать с младшими разработчиками.
Что должен уметь мидл‑специалист
Мидл-специалист, находясь между уровнями джуна и сеньора, должен обладать определенным набором навыков и компетенций, благодаря которым он будет успешно выполнять свои задачи и взаимодействовать в команде. Вот некоторые из них:
- Написание качественного и понятного кода с использованием необходимых технологий и языков программирования.
- Уверенное владение интегрированными средами разработки (IDE) и использование сочетаний клавиш для быстрой и эффективной работы.
- Глубокое понимание функционирования платформ и технологий, связанных с его областью работы.
- Управление и разработка баз данных, включая хранимые процедуры, триггеры и объектно-реляционное отображение (ORM).
- Активное сотрудничество с членами команды, включая руководство над младшими разработчиками.
- Самостоятельность в работе и способность находить нестандартные решения.
Софтскилы для мидла: развитие эффективных навыков коммуникации
- Коммуникативные навыки и способность ясно и эффективно общаться с коллегами и клиентами.
- Умение работать в команде, делиться знаниями и опытом, помогать и поддерживать младших разработчиков.
- Управление временем и организация работы, чтобы эффективно выполнять задачи и достигать поставленных целей.
- Гибкость и адаптивность, способность адекватно реагировать на изменения и новые требования проекта.
- Проактивность и стремление к самосовершенствованию, включая изучение новых технологий и методологий разработки.
Какая зарплата у middle-разработчика
Зарплата разработчика уровня middle варьируется в зависимости от местоположения, размера компании, специализации и опыта работы. Однако, middle-разработчики обычно получают более высокую зарплату, чем джуниоры, но ниже, чем у сеньоров. Средняя зарплата middle-разработчика от $1000 до $2500 в месяц, но но эти цифры изменяются в зависимости от рыночных условий.
Совет эксперта: как мидлу скорее выйти на уровень сеньор
- Продолжайте развиваться и углублять свои технические навыки. Изучайте новые технологии и языки программирования, принимайте участие в профессиональных мероприятиях и обменивайтесь опытом с коллегами.
- Показывайте лидерские качества и возьмите на себя больше ответственности в проектах. Участвуйте в процессах принятия решений, предлагайте идеи по улучшению архитектуры и стратегий разработки.
- Наставничество и помощь младшим разработчикам может дать вам возможность показать свои лидерские навыки и укрепить свою позицию в команде.
- Проявляйте инициативу и интерес к новым задачам и проектам. Будьте готовы принять больше ответственности и выполнять задачи выше уровня мидла.
Развивая свои софтскиллы, коммуникативные навыки, тайм-менеджмент и организацию работы, middle-разработчик может стать полноценным лидером и претендовать на высшие позиции в разработке.
Senior-разработчик: определение и обязанности
Сеньор-разработчик — это высококвалифицированный специалист в своей области, обладающий обширным опытом и экспертизой. Он один из ключевых сотрудников команды разработки и обычно имеет лидерскую роль. Разработчик уровня Senior отличается глубоким пониманием архитектуры системы, способностью принимать стратегические решения и руководить процессами внутри команды.
Что должен уметь сеньор-разработчик
- Обладать глубокими техническими знаниями и навыками в своей области разработки.
- Проектировать сложные архитектуры и эффективно решать проблемы в разработке программного обеспечения.
- Владеть различными языками программирования, фреймворками и инструментами, связанными с его областью работы.
- Уметь проводить аудит кода и предлагать улучшения для оптимизации процессов разработки и повышения качества продукта.
- Обладать навыками руководства и способностью эффективно коммуницировать с другими членами команды и заинтересованными сторонами.
Софтскилы сеньор-разработчика: развитие навыков руководства и командной работы
- Лидерство и способность организовывать работу команды и управлять проектами.
- Коммуникативные навыки, умение ясно и эффективно общаться с коллегами и клиентами.
- Менторство и способность передавать знания и опыт младшим разработчикам.
- Умение принимать стратегические решения и видеть долгосрочные перспективы развития проекта.
- Гибкость и адаптивность для работы с различными людьми и изменяющимися требованиями проекта.
Какая зарплата у senior-разработчика
Зарплата сеньор-разработчика зависит от ряда факторов: местоположения, опыта работы, специализации и размера компании. Преимущественно они получают более высокую зарплату, чем middle- и junior-разработчики. В среднем, зарплатная вилка разработчика на PHP уровня Senior составляет от 3000 до 5000 долларов в месяц.
Как Senior скорее выйти на уровень Lead
Продолжайте развиваться в своей области и стратегическом руководстве, изучайте новые технологии и методологии разработки.
- Займите руководящую роль в проектах и покажите свою способность эффективно управлять командой и процессами разработки.
- Проявляйте инициативу и предлагайте инновационные решения. Вносите практическую ценность в проекты и продукты, с которыми работаете.
- Работайте над своими софтскилами, такими как коммуникация, руководство и управление временем. Эти навыки помогут вам стать полноценным лидером и преуспеть на более высоких уровнях развития.
- Обратитесь к карьерным планам и рекомендациям, предоставленным GeekBrains, чтобы получить дополнительные советы и поддержку на пути к достижению высшего уровня в разработке программного обеспечения.
Прокачивайтесь с помощью профессиональных курсов и образовательных программ, таких как курсы GeekBrains, чтобы расширить свои знания и навыки.
Градация специалистов и ее значение
Градация специалистов Junior, Middle и Senior широко применяется в сфере разработки и IT-индустрии в целом. Она позволяет оценить уровень опыта, навыков и ответственности участников команды. Разделение специалистов на уровни помогает HR-менеджерам и руководителям определить роли и задачи, а также обеспечивает структурированную систему роста и карьерного развития.
Платформа GeekBrains помогает студентам овладеть новыми технологиями, изучить лучшие практики разработки и узнать о современных трендах в отрасли. Более того, GeekBrains предоставляет возможность работать над реальными проектами, что помогает студентам приобрести практический опыт и построить свое портфолио. Это дает им преимущество при поиске работы на уровне middle и senior, а также способствует их профессиональному росту. Поэтому, выбрав обучение на сайте GeekBrains, вы получаете надежный путь для развития своей карьеры в области разработки программного обеспечения. Переход между уровнями требует времени, усилий и постоянного самообразования. Ed-tech платформа GeekBrains предоставляет отличные возможности для развития разработчиков программного обеспечения на каждом этапе их карьеры. Благодаря актуальным программам и практическим занятиям, студенты могут приобрести необходимые знания и умения для перехода на следующий уровень.
Получить консультацию
Отправляя заявку, вы принимаете условия публичного договора и даете согласие на обработку своих персональных данных в соответствии с политикой конфиденциальности.
Отправляя заявку, вы принимаете условия публичного договора и даете согласие на обработку своих персональных данных в соответствии с политикой конфиденциальности.
Последние статьи:
5
6 минут
7 сентября, 2024
Кто такой product owner и чем он занимается?
Статья предназначена для широкого круга читателей, включая тех, кто только начинает свою карьеру в IT, и опытных профессионалов, желающих углубить свои знания о роли Product Owner.
11
5 минут
5 сентября, 2024
Виды графиков и диаграмм: полное руководство
В этой статье мы рассмотрим различные виды графиков и диаграмм, их особенности и применения. Вы узнаете, какой тип визуализации подходит для определенных задач и как правильно интерпретировать данные, представленные в графической форме.
16
4 минуты
3 сентября, 2024
Лучшие гуманитарные профессии: обзор и перспективы обучения
Статья нацелена на предоставление исчерпывающего обзора лучших гуманитарных профессий и анализа перспектив их обучения.